Description
A practical, easy-to-read casebook on New Zealand tort law
Torts in New Zealand: Cases and Materials is the principal introductory torts casebook in New Zealand. Now in its sixth edition, this popular textbook has been updated to reflect legislative changes and new cases with revised commentary. The focus of the text is on New Zealand tort law and its accident compensation scheme. However it also uses precedents from UK, Canada and Australia to reflect the diverse sources of New Zealand tort law.
New to this Edition:
- Revised content to reflect changes in New Zealand law
- Updated case studies in regards to accident compensation and the range of torts covered
- Updated problem questions integrated throughout the book provide a scaffolded approach to learning and enable students to test their knowledge.
